Responsibilities

  • Lead execution of automation and control system projects from initiation to completion, ensuring delivery within scope, schedule, and quality requirements.
  • Review customer specifications and define project scope, key deliverables, and technical requirements in line with applicable standards.
  • Support bid and proposal activities by developing technical solutions, coordinating with vendors, and contributing to RFQs and evaluations.
  • Plan and conduct site surveys, assessing site conditions, logistics, safety requirements, and overall project feasibility.
  • Oversee system design and engineering activities for PLC, DCS, SCADA, and related automation systems.
  • Guide development of engineering deliverables such as IO lists, control narratives, and design documentation.
  • Supervise software configuration and application development for control systems and HMI/SCADA platforms.
  • Coordinate with procurement teams and vendors to ensure timely availability of materials and services.
  • Manage subcontractors and monitor progress, quality, and compliance with project requirements.
  • Lead testing activities including FAT and SAT, ensuring systems meet functional and performance expectations.
  • Oversee site execution activities such as installation, commissioning, startup, and handover while ensuring compliance with safety standards.
  • Ensure adherence to relevant international standards and company procedures throughout project execution.
  • Manage project documentation, reporting, and scheduling using standard business and project management tools.
  • Collaborate with internal teams, customers, and stakeholders to resolve issues and ensure smooth project delivery.
